Brahma Vaivarta Purana Chapter 21:81-90

ENGLISH TRANSLATION

81.To attain purification one should give food to all living entities. Still, by giving to exalted living entities one attains a better result.

82.By giving to human beings one attains a result eight times better than by giving to lower species. By giving to a çüdra one attains a result two times better than that.

83.By giving food to vaiçyas one attains a result eight times better than that, and by giving food to kñatriyas one attains a result two times better still.

84.By giving food to brähmaëas one attains a result a hundred times better than by giving to kñatriyas. By giving food to a brähmana learned in the scriptures one attains a result a hundred times better than by giving to ordinary brähmanas.

85.By giving food to a brähmaëa devotee of the Lord one attains a result a hundred times better than be giving to a brähmana learned in the scriptures. A devotee brähmana offers the food to Lord Hari and then eats the remnants with respect and devotion.

86.By feeding a devotee-brähmaëa one attains the result of giving charity to a devotee-brähmaëa and to Lord Viñëu.

87.When a devotee is pleased, then Lord Hari is pleased. When Lord Hari is pleased then all the demigods become pleased, as by watering the root all of a tree's branches are also watered.

88.If by offering all these things to one demigod the others are displeased, what good result will this one demigod grant?

89.Instead, you should offer all these things to the hill that because it nourishes (vardhana) the cows (go) is called Govardhana.

90.O father, on this earth no one is pious and saintly like Govardhana Hill, which every day gives new grasses to the cows.
